Detailed Forecast

This Afternoon
Snow likely, mainly before 5pm. Mostly cloudy, with a high near 33. West wind around 11 mph, with gusts as high as 40 mph. Chance of precipitation is 70%. Total daytime snow accumulation of 3 to 5 inches possible.
Tonight
Snow, mainly after 8pm. The snow could be heavy at times. Low around 25. Northwest wind 7 to 16 mph, with gusts as high as 25 mph. Chance of precipitation is 90%. New snow accumulation of 3 to 5 inches possible.
Friday
Snow, mainly before 8am. The snow could be heavy at times. High near 35. West wind 7 to 9 mph. Chance of precipitation is 80%. New snow accumulation of 2 to 4 inches possible.
Friday Night
A 50 percent chance of snow.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 21. Northwest wind 7 to 9 mph. New snow accumulation of less than a half inch possible.
Saturday
A 40 percent chance of snow, mainly before 11am. Partly sunny, with a high near 31. West wind 10 to 15 mph, with gusts as high as 28 mph. Little or no snow accumulation expected.
Saturday Night
Partly cloudy, with a low around 19.
Sunday
A 50 percent chance of snow, mainly after 11am. Partly sunny, with a high near 33. New snow accumulation of less than a half inch possible.
Sunday Night
Snow likely before 2am, then snow likely, possibly mixed with rain.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 28. Chance of precipitation is 70%.
Monday
Rain likely, possibly mixed with snow before 11am, then a chance of rain. Mostly cloudy, with a high near 44. Chance of precipitation is 70%.
Monday Night
A 30 percent chance of rain.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 36.
Tuesday
A 40 percent chance of rain. Partly sunny, with a high near 49.
Tuesday Night
A 50 percent chance of rain.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 40.
Wednesday
Rain likely. Mostly cloudy, with a high near 49. Chance of precipitation is 60%.
Wednesday Night
A chance of rain and snow.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 37. Chance of precipitation is 50%.
Thursday
A chance of rain and snow. Partly sunny, with a high near 47. Chance of precipitation is 40%.
